The estimate provided with the 2021 planning statement for the application was for 26,711 tonnes of carbon from the project to be offset. The WSP report says that the changes arise from changes in the way the Department for Transport now calculate carbon impact - adding that the authority has only had to provide the updated figure because it needs to be included in its submission of a 'business case' for the road to the government.
